The reliability of airborne light detection and ranging (LiDAR) for delineating individual trees and estimating aboveground biomass (AGB) has been proven in a diverse range of ecosystems, but can be ...difficult and costly to commission. Point clouds derived from structure from motion (SfM) matching techniques obtained from unmanned aerial systems (UAS) could be a feasible low-cost alternative to airborne LiDAR scanning for canopy parameter retrieval. This study assesses the extent to which SfM three-dimensional (3D) point clouds-obtained from a light-weight mini-UAS quadcopter with an inexpensive consumer action GoPro camera-can efficiently and effectively detect individual trees, measure tree heights, and provide AGB estimates in Australian tropical savannas. Two well-established canopy maxima and watershed segmentation tree detection algorithms were tested on canopy height models (CHM) derived from SfM imagery. The influence of CHM spatial resolution on tree detection accuracy was analysed, and the results were validated against existing high-resolution airborne LiDAR data. We found that the canopy maxima and watershed segmentation routines produced similar tree detection rates (~70%) for dominant and co-dominant trees, but yielded low detection rates (<35%) for suppressed and small trees due to poor representativeness in point clouds and overstory occlusion. Although airborne LiDAR provides higher tree detection rates and more accurate estimates of tree heights, we found SfM image matching to be an adequate low-cost alternative for the detection of dominant and co-dominant tree stands.
A chill sequence at the base of the Lower Zone of the western Bushveld Complex at Union Section, South Africa, contains aphanitic Mg-rich basaltic andesite and spinifex-textured komatiite. The ...basaltic andesite has an average composition of 15.2 % MgO, 52.8 % SiO
2
, 1205 ppm Cr, and 361 ppm Ni, whereas the komatiite has 18.7 % MgO, 1515 ppm Cr, and 410 ppm Ni. Both rock types have very low concentrations of immobile incompatible elements (0.14–0.72 ppm Nb, 7–31 ppm Zr, 0.34–0.69 ppm Th, 0.23–0.27 wt% TiO
2
), but high PGE contents (19–23 ppb Pt, 15–16 ppb Pd) and Pt/Pd ratios (Pt/Pd 1.4). Strontium and S isotopes show enriched signatures relative to most other Lower Zone rocks. The rocks could represent a ~20 % partial melt of subcontinental lithospheric mantle. This would match the PGE content of the rocks. However, this model is inconsistent with the high SiO
2
, Fe, and Na
2
O contents and, in particular, the low K
2
O, Zr, Hf, Nb, Ta, Th, LREE, Rb, and Ba contents of the rocks. Alternatively, the chills could represent a komatiitic magma derived from the asthenosphere that underwent assimilation of the quartzitic floor accompanied by crystallization of olivine and chromite. This model is consistent with the lithophile elements and the elevated Sr and S isotopic signatures of the rocks. However, in order to account for the high Pt and Pd contents of the magma, the mantle must have been twice as rich in PGE as the current estimate for PUM, possibly due to a component of incompletely equilibrated late veneer.

Models of emotional labor suggest that emotional labor leads to strain and affects job performance. Although the link between emotional labor, strain, and performance has been well documented in ...cross-sectional field studies, not much is known about the causal direction of relationships between emotional labor, strain, and performance. Goal of the present study was therefore to test the direction of effects in a two-wave longitudinal panel study using a sample of 151 trainee teachers. Longitudinal lagged effects were tested using structural equation modeling. Results revealed that the emotional labor strategy of surface acting led to increases in subsequent strain while deep acting led to increases in job performance. In contrast, there was no indication of reverse causation: Neither strain nor job performance had a significant lagged effect on subsequent surface or deep acting. Overall, results support models of emotional labor suggesting that surface and deep acting causally precede individual and organizational well-being.
Although the topic of value congruence has attracted considerable attention from researchers and practitioners, evidence for the link between person-supervisor value congruence and followers' ...reactions is less robust than often assumed. This study addresses three central issues in our understanding of person-supervisor value congruence (a) by assessing the impact of objective person-supervisor value congruence rather than subjective value congruence, (b) by examining the differential effects of value congruence in strongly versus moderately held values, and (c) by exploring perceived empowerment as a central mediating mechanism. Results of a multi-source study comprising 116 person-supervisor dyads reveal that objective value congruence relates to followers' job satisfaction and affective commitment and that this link can be explained by followers' perceived empowerment. Moreover, polynomial regression and response surface analyses reveal that congruence effects vary with the importance that leaders and followers ascribe to a certain value: Congruency in strongly held values have more robust relations with followers' outcomes than congruence in moderately held values.
Young people with self-experienced cognitive thought and perception deficits (basic symptoms) may present with an early initial prodromal state (EIPS) of psychosis in which most of the disability and ...neurobiological deficits of schizophrenia have not yet occurred.
To investigate the effects of an integrated psychological intervention (IPI), combining individual cognitive-behavioural therapy, group skills training, cognitive remediation and multifamily psychoeducation, on the prevention of psychosis in the EIPS.
A randomised controlled, multicentre, parallel group trial of 12 months of IPI v. supportive counselling (trial registration number: NCT00204087). Primary outcome was progression to psychosis at 12- and 24-month follow-up.
A total of 128 help-seeking out-patients in an EIPS were randomised. Integrated psychological intervention was superior to supportive counselling in preventing progression to psychosis at 12-month follow-up (3.2% v. 16.9%; P = 0.008) and at 24-month follow-up (6.3% v. 20.0%; P = 0.019).
Integrated psychological intervention appears effective in delaying the onset of psychosis over a 24-month time period in people in an EIPS.
The Labrador Trough in northern Quebec is currently the focus of ongoing exploration for magmatic Ni-Cu-platinum group element (PGE) sulphide ores. This geological belt hosts voluminous basaltic ...sills and lavas of the Montagnais Sill Complex, which are locally emplaced among sulphidic metasedimentary country rocks. The recently discovered Idefix PGE-Cu prospect represents a stack of gabbroic sills that host stratiform patchy disseminated to net-textured sulphides (0.2-0.4 g/t PGE+Au) over a thickness of ∼20 m, for up to 7 km. In addition, globular sulphides occur at the base of the sill, adjacent to the metasedimentary floor rocks. Whole-rock and PGE geochemistry indicates that the sills share a common source and that the extracted magma underwent significant fractionation before emplacement in the upper crust. To develop the PGE-enriched ores, sulphide melt saturation was attained before final emplacement, peaking at R factors of ∼10 000. Globular sulphides entrained along the base of the sill ingested crustally derived arsenic and were ultimately preserved in the advancing chilled margin.
The influence of the preparation method on structural properties and on the catalytic activity of sol–gel derived binary copper manganese oxides for CO oxidation in dry air at room temperature has ...been investigated. The catalysts were characterised by means of BET and X-ray diffraction. All results were compared with a commercial Hopcalite sample. Subsequent conventional optimisation of the most active sample – prepared by the so-called ethylene–glycol method (EG I) – including compositional and calcination temperature variation revealed Cu
20Mn
80O
x
(EG I) calcined at 400
°C as very active catalyst. Sintering processes induced by the crystallisation of the amorphous material above 400
°C cause a dramatic decrease of the catalysts’ surface area accompanied by deactivation. XPS data recordings were used to investigate the oxidation states of the metals in this catalyst and in the reference material. In conclusion a combination of high surface area, amorphous state and the presence of Cu
2+ and Mn
3+ was found to be essential for the high catalytic activity of the binary copper manganese oxides. The reactivity of the best catalyst was tested under application-relevant conditions, i.e. in moist air and at low-temperature fuel cell conditions.
Research on the relationship of implicit motives and effective leadership emphasises the importance of a socialised need for power, whereas high levels of the need for affiliation are assumed to ...thwart a leader’s success. In our study, we experimentally analysed the impact of leaders’ socialised need for power and their need for affiliation on perceptions of transformational leadership and various success indicators. Using paper-people vignettes, we contrasted leaders characterised by either motive with those concerned with personalised power or achievement. Results based on
N
= 80 employees show that leaders high in socialised power were rated more successful and elicited more identification and organisational citizenship behaviour (OCB) in followers, and that in most cases this effect was mediated by perceptions of transformational leadership. For all outcomes but OCB, findings remained unchanged when affiliation-motivated leaders were considered. Exploratory analyses contrasting socialised power-motivated and affiliation-motivated leaders show that with regard to attitudinal outcomes affiliation-motivated leaders were, on average, as effective as socialised power-motivated ones.

The Palaeoproterozoic Penikat layered ultramafic–mafic intrusion in northern Finland is one of the most richly mineralized layered intrusions on Earth, containing at least six platinum-group ...element (PGE) enriched horizons exposed along >20 km of strike, amongst them the SJ reef, which at ∼3–7 ppm Pt + Pd over a width of ∼1–2 m is surpassed by few other PGE reefs globally in terms of its endowment in PGE. Important PGE enrichments also occur in the PV reef (average 2·6 ppm Pd, 4 ppm Pt over 1·1 m) and AP1 reef (average 6·2 ppm Pd, 1·7 ppm Pt over 0·7 m). Here we present new major and high-precision trace element and Nd isotope data from a traverse across the intrusion, and a new U–Pb age of 2444 ± 8 Ma for the intrusion. We show that the PGE reefs formed by predominantly orthomagmatic processes as, for example, reflected by well-defined positive correlations between Pt + Pd and Os + Ir + Ru contents. Late-magmatic fluids played no significant role in concentrating PGE. There are at least six cyclic units in the intrusion, displaying a progressive upward decrease in differentiation indices Mg# and Cr/V. Subdued stratigraphic variations in incompatible trace element ratios (Ce/Sm mostly 5–10) and Nd isotope compositions (εNd –3 to –1) indicate that mixing of magmas of distinct lineage, or in situ contamination with country rocks, was not required to form the PGE reefs. There is also no evidence for addition of external sulphur to the magma, based on S/Se ratios at, or below, primitive mantle levels. Instead, we propose that sulphide melt saturation at Penikat was reached in response to fractionation of a siliceous, high-magnesium basalt, and that the sulphides were concentrated through hydrodynamic phase sorting, consistent with bonanza-style PGE grades in large potholes.
Asthma management guidelines provide recommendations for the optimum control of asthma. This survey assessed the current levels of asthma control as reported by patients, which partly reflect the ...extent to which guideline recommendations are implemented. Current asthma patients were identified by telephone by screening 73,880 households in seven European countries. Designated respondents were interviewed on healthcare utilization, symptom severity, activity limitations and asthma control. Current asthma patients were identified in 3,488 households, and 2,803 patients (80.4%) completed the survey. Forty-six per cent of patients reported daytime symptoms and 30% reported asthma-related sleep disturbances, at least once a week. In the past 12 months, 25% of patients reported an unscheduled urgent care visit, 10% reported one or more emergency room visits and 7% reported overnight hospitalization due to asthma. In the past 4 weeks, more patients had used prescription quick-relief medication (63%) than inhaled corticosteroids (23%). Patient perception of asthma control did not match their symptom severity; approximately 50% of patients reporting severe persistent symptoms also considered their asthma to be completely or well controlled. The current level of asthma control in Europe falls far short of the goals for long-term asthma management. Patients' perception of asthma control is different from their actual asthma control.
